Why Multi-Generational Marketing Matters

Every generation interacts with content differently. Your marketing strategy must adapt to the behaviors, values, and expectations of your audience segments. Here’s a quick breakdown:

  • Gen Z (ages ~11–28): Digital natives who crave authenticity, video content, and social causes. Marketing to Gen Z means leveraging platforms like TikTok and Instagram Reels with short, visual content and strong storytelling.

  • Millennials (ages ~29–43): Tech-savvy and values-driven, they prefer email marketing, Instagram, and influencer endorsements. Successful millennial marketing strategies focus on convenience, transparency, and reviews.

  • Gen X (ages ~44–59): Often overlooked, but highly influential. They respond well to Facebook ads, email newsletters, and practical value-driven content.

  • Baby Boomers (ages ~60+): Still active online—especially on Facebook and via email—but they appreciate clear messaging and trust-based marketing. Marketing to baby boomers requires a respectful, informative tone.

3 Ways to Reach Every Generation Effectively

  1. Tailor Your Social Media Strategy
    Don’t spread yourself too thin—invest in the platforms where your target audience is most active. For example, use Instagram for millennials, TikTok for Gen Z, and Facebook for Gen X and Boomers.

  2. Segment Your Email Campaigns
    Not all customers want the same updates. Create segmented lists so your Gen Z customers get punchy, mobile-friendly content, while Boomers receive more detailed information with a clear call-to-action.

  3. Use Content Variety
    Video, blogs, carousel posts, emails—different formats resonate with different demographics. Mix it up to maintain engagement across generations.
